New York Times bestselling author and Eisner-nominated creator of iZombie, Chris Roberson, delivers a magical new series with art by Rich Ellis. Memorial is the story of Em, a young woman who arrives at a hospital in Portland, Oregon, with no memory of her past. A year later, she has rebuilt her life, only to find her existence thrown into turmoil after she inherits a magical shop and is drawn into a supernatural conflict between beings that not only represent, but are, fundamental elements of the universe itself!

New York Times Bestselling author Chris Roberson is best known for his Eisner nominated ongoing comic book series iZombie, co-created with artist Mike Allred, and multiple Cinderella mini-series set in the world of Bill Willingham's Fables. He has written more than a dozen novels and numerous short stories, as well as many other comic projects including Superman, Stan Lee's Starborn, Elric: The Balance Lost, Memorial, and Do Androids Dream of Electric Sheep?: Dust to Dust. He has been a finalist for the World Fantasy Award four times; twice a finalist for the John W. Campbell Award for Best New Writer; and has won the Sidewise Award for Best Alternate History in both the Short Form and Novel categories. Chris lives with his wife and daughter in Portland, Oregon.

There are six issues in the Memorial miniseries by Chris Roberson. All six are available individually; it looks like publicity started around the end of 2011 and the six issues came out in 2012. This book, "Memorial HC" gathers the first three issues in one omnibus, along with covers and the like.

So, why should this matter? Well, this is a wonderfully compelling series, and the individual issues are so hard to find that the "Memorial HC" omnibus edition may be your only shot at the first three. Roberson is the author of Vertigo Comics' "iZombie" and IDW's "Star Trek/Legion Of Super-Heroes" crossover. This Memorial series is a different series and recounts the adventures of Em, a young woman with amnesia who is given an unusual key when she visits a strange curio shop. The shop's door transports Em to fantastic lands, and she meets a variety of helpful and threatening characters as she tries to avoid enemies who are hunting for her for unknown reasons. Em keeps her wits about her and is a heroine you are happy to travel with.
